推荐项目:SwiftUI滑动覆盖卡

推荐项目:SwiftUI滑动覆盖卡

swiftUI-slide-over-cardSlide over modal/card for SwiftUI项目地址:https://gitcode.com/gh_mirrors/sw/swiftUI-slide-over-card

在追求极致用户体验的今天,开发者们总是在寻找那些能够为应用增添一抹亮色的小细节。今天要为大家隆重推荐的是一个旨在提升交互体验的开源项目——Slide Over Card for SwiftUI。它是一个优雅的解决方案,让你的应用通过简单的滑动操作展示信息卡片,既美观又实用。

项目介绍

Slide Over Card for SwiftUI 是一款专为 SwiftUI 设计的组件,它允许开发者轻松地在应用中实现滑动覆盖效果。这个轻量级的组件通过一段简洁的代码就能集成到你的下一个或现有项目中,为你带来流畅的滑动显示和隐藏效果,非常适合快速展示重要信息或操作入口。

技术分析

借助 Swift Package Manager 的便捷性,开发者可以无缝接入这个库。项目充分利用了 SwiftUI 的声明式编程模型,让组件的状态管理变得异常简单。通过定制 CardPosition(顶部、中间或底部)和 BackgroundStyle(模糊、透明或实色),开发者能灵活调整卡片的外观与位置,满足不同场景下的设计需求。

源码示例清晰易懂,即便是初学者也能迅速上手。借助状态管理特性,使用者可以直接通过视图模型来控制卡片的行为,体现了高度的响应式设计原则。

应用场景

Slide Over Card 具有广泛的应用范围:

  • 在社交媒体应用中,作为快速分享或点赞功能的入口。
  • 在导航软件中,提供临时路线选择或者地图设置选项。
  • 在阅读应用中,展示书籍详情或笔记功能。
  • 在电商平台,用来快捷查看商品详情或加入购物车。

无论你是想增强已有界面的互动性,还是希望为新项目添加创意元素,这个组件都是不可多得的选择。

项目特点

  • 简易集成:通过Swift Package Manager简化集成过程,无需复杂的配置。
  • 高度可定制:支持自定义显示位置和背景样式,轻松融入各种设计风格。
  • 响应式设计:利用SwiftUI的强大能力,使得组件状态与用户交互紧密相连。
  • 交互友好:直观的滑动操作提升用户体验,使信息呈现更加生动有趣。
  • 学习资源丰富:基于现有的SwiftUI知识,开发者可以快速上手并进行二次开发。

总结而言,Slide Over Card for SwiftUI 不仅是一个技术实现的典范,也是提升用户体验的一个巧妙工具。对于正在寻求应用创新点的开发者来说,它无疑是一次值得尝试的合作。立即集成,让你的应用焕然一新,提升用户的每一次触碰体验!

swiftUI-slide-over-cardSlide over modal/card for SwiftUI项目地址:https://gitcode.com/gh_mirrors/sw/swiftUI-slide-over-card

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

宣勇磊Tanya

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值